CVE-2024-8418
Last modified
CVE-2024-8418 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.5/10 on the CVSS scale. A flaw was found in Aardvark-dns, which is vulnerable to a Denial of Service attack due to the serial processing of TCP DNS queries. An attacker can exploit this flaw by keeping a TCP connection open indefinitely, causing the server to become unresponsive and resulting in other DNS queries timing out. EPSS estimates a 0.76%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

This issue prevents legitimate users from accessing DNS services, thereby disrupting normal operations and causing service downtime.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Containers | Aardvark-Dns | 1.12.0 |
| Containers | Aardvark-Dns | 1.12.1 |
